Planned Gifts for the Future

There are two main types of planned gifts, life income gifts and bequests. While a bequest is a gift left in your will, life income gifts allow you to donate to NOLS now, but keep or increase the income from your assets.

Catherine "CeCe" Sieffert says that the experiences on her NOLS Semester in the Rockies "allowed me to realize and foster my self-confidence and initiative, and, in turn, translate those into teamwork and leadership skills."

Twelve years later, in 2008, CeCe and her husband decided to spend a year traveling through Asia and Africa. Before embarking on her trip, she thought hard about the future and the people and institutions she cared about. "Even though we were only 32, the smart thing to do was write a will," She said. In it, she named NOLS as a beneficiary.

"[My husband and I] are still fairly young, and not terribly wealthy, but I found it important to include NOLS because my course was such a positive experience for me. Were the worst to happen, I want to leave behind a legacy that allows others to have that positive experience also."
